Q: How much does a car locksmith service cost?A: The cost of a car locksmith service can vary depending upon the kind of service, the complexity of the lock, and the area. Normally, you can expect to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150 for a standard car lockout service. Key replacement and programming can vary from ₤ 75 to ₤ 200.
Q: Can a locksmith open a car without a key?A: Yes, an expert locksmith can utilize different tools and methods, such as lock choices or slim jims, to open a car mobile locksmith near me without a key. They are trained to do this efficiently and without causing damage to the vehicle.
Q: Is it legal for a locksmith to open my car?A: Yes, it is legal for a locksmith near me for car to open your car, offered they validate your identity and ownership of the vehicle. This is a standard practice to guarantee the security and stability of the service.
Q: How long does it consider a locksmith to open a car?A: The time it takes for a locksmith to open a car can differ, but it generally takes between 5 and 30 minutes. Aspects like the kind of lock and the locksmith's experience can affect the period.
Q: Can a locksmith make a brand-new key for my car?A: Yes, an expert locksmith can create a brand-new key for your car. They can also program transponder keys for contemporary automobiles.
Q: Do I require to be present when the locksmith arrives?A: Yes, it is necessary to be present when the locksmith arrives. They need to verify your identity and ownership of the vehicle before supplying service.
Q: Can a locksmith car near me replace a broken ignition switch?A: Yes, lots of locksmiths use ignition switch repair and replacement services. They can identify the issue and replace the switch if required.
